The execution is believed to be in retaliation for recent airstrikes by Syrian and Russian forces which targeted ISIS-held territory in and around Yarmouk camp.


The area has seen heavy fighting since government forces began a campaign to retake rebel-held towns on the outskirts of the Syrian capital.


Before the Syrian war broke out in 2011, Yarmouk was home to Syria's largest Palestinian refugee population.


ISIS has been driven out from its so-called "Caliphate" in Syria and Iraq.


But the terror group still controls pockets of territory and seized Yarmouk during the height of its power in 2015.


The UN has warned around 1,200 civilians are still trapped in the besieged camp and have no access to food or medical supplies.


Pierre Krahenbuhl, commissioner-general of UNRWA, the UN agency responsible for Palestinian refugees, said: "Yarmouk and its inhabitants have endured indescribable pain and suffering over years of conflict.


We are deeply concerned about the fate of thousands of civilians, including Palestine refugees, after more than a week of dramatically increased violence.”
